A bold and striking gold and black jade bangle by Angela Cummings circa 1980s, the bangle in 18ct yellow gold with rounded domed D-shape profile and curved undulating form, inlaid throughout with thirty oval carved and polished pieces of black jade, to a side hinged opening with concealed tongue and box clasp. This is a classic and instantly recognisable design from Cummings, her inlaid jewels, particularly those in black jade are highly collectible. The bangle has a lovely weight to it and is very comfortable to wear. A great statement piece that looks as good worn alone as it does with others.
